Transaction 2006182a2ffe744f89569a99bfb061f04fc01209a28c29908351c70ecf1879d7
1 Input
1 Output
-
2006182a2ffe744f89569a99bfb061f04fc01209a28c29908351c70ecf1879d7:0
- value
- 25368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e86ee7800796af81423b3335af009b335fda512e OP_EQUAL
- address
- 3Nt1YpApZ6r3gfDzvHmDQVYF4kyPPXTFqL